Sonos to launch Play portable speaker in India at Rs 35,999 on September 8

Sonos is set to introduce its Play portable speaker in India on September 8. Priced at Rs 35,999, the device offers Wi-Fi and Bluetooth grouping, up to 24 hours of battery life, IP67 protection, a built-in power bank and a replaceable battery.
